Is Zoro a drunk?

Zoro isn’t an alcoholic but he surely enjoys drinking sake after every occasion. He doesn’t want the crew to have a huge stock of alcohol in the ship and isn’t stubborn to make any ruckus about it.

What does Zoro drink?

sake
Zoro stole a gourd bottle of sake from the Beast Pirates, and had carried it around since then to drink sake. During Orochi’s banquets, he would drink only top quality sake brewed by a famous sake maker named Touji.

Is Luffy drink alcohol?

Yes. He drinks alcohol on several occasions. The earliest of these is when he drank sake with Ace and Sabo to become brothers. In the main storyline most arcs have an ending “party” scene where everyone drinks.

Why did Luffy say he doesn’t drink alcohol?

The thing is, though, Luffy is underage. Since One Piece’s mid-narrative time skip he’s been 19 years old, which makes him below the legal drinking age of 20 in Japan. “On the high seas, water in barrels will turn bad, but alcohol will keep, so if you don’t drink it you’ll die.”

Does Zoro love beer?

Give the guy some sake or beer and he’s a happy camper. Zoro is no stranger to the world of alcohol. In fact, aside from training, dueling, and sleeping, Zoro might claim drinking as his main hobby. In the post-time skip, during a celebration, Zoro can be seen indulging in alcohol.

How old is Zoro?

Roronoa Zoro
Gender Male
Age 19 years old (debut) 21 years old (after timeskip)
Height 178 cm (5’10”) (debut) 181 cm (5’11”) (after timeskip)
Weight 85 kg (187 lbs)

How did Buggy get his body back?

When Buggy comes and makes his body parts connect he commands them beat up the nearby bear claw tribe members and let the crew out of the pot. After that, he summons his body parts to completely reassemble.
